Plain-English summary
CVE-2021-4352 lets unauthenticated internet users change settings in the JobSearch WP Job Board WordPress plugin through version 1.8.1. The known impact is limited to integrity of plugin configuration, not data theft or full server takeover based on the provided sources.
Executive priority
Treat this as a moderate-priority WordPress exposure. It is not described as actively exploited, but unauthenticated settings changes can disrupt hiring workflows, alter site behavior, and create operational risk on public websites.
Technical view
The vulnerability is a missing authorization check in the plugin's save_locsettings function. It is classified as CWE-284 and scored CVSS 5.3: network exploitable, low complexity, no privileges or user interaction required, with low integrity impact only.
Likely exposure
Exposure is limited to WordPress sites running JobSearch WP Job Board version 1.8.1 or earlier, especially public sites where unauthenticated requests can reach plugin endpoints.
Exploitation context
The source bundle does not show CISA KEV listing or cited evidence of active exploitation. The issue is still practical because it requires no login and targets a public WordPress plugin path.
Researcher notes
Key evidence is the missing capability check on save_locsettings in versions up to and including 1.8.1. Public sources support integrity impact, not confidentiality or availability impact. The bundle does not provide exploit details or a confirmed fixed version number.
Mitigation direction
- Inventory WordPress sites for JobSearch WP Job Board installations.
- Confirm whether installed versions are 1.8.1 or earlier.
- Check vendor, Wordfence, WPScan, or Nintechnet guidance for the fixed release.
- Upgrade to a vendor-confirmed fixed version when available.
- If no fix is available, disable the plugin until guidance is confirmed.
Validation and detection
- Verify plugin version from WordPress admin or asset inventory.
- Review plugin settings for unexpected or unauthorized changes.
- Check web and WordPress logs for suspicious unauthenticated plugin-setting requests.
- Confirm post-remediation version is newer than the affected range.
- Monitor Wordfence or WPScan entries for updated exploit or patch information.
